📚 Contexto Histórico

In the Book of Numbers, which details the Israelites' organization and laws during their wilderness journey after the Exodus from Egypt, the Levites were a tribe specifically chosen by God to assist in the tabernacle's sacred duties, taking over roles that might otherwise have been assigned to the firstborn of all tribes. This verse outlines the minimum age of 25 for Levites to begin their service, ensuring they were mature and capable for handling holy responsibilities in the tabernacle. This regulation helped maintain order and reverence in Israel's religious practices as they traveled toward the Promised Land.
